Interviewed Nov 2010 in Pittsburgh, PA (took 2 days)
I was initially really impressed with the company during the first round. The final round was a lot more shady. It seemed as if right off the bat the HR people had favorites and if you weren't one of them, it felt as if you were literally wasting your time. They spent a lot of time badmouthing Abercrombie and trying to convince everyone how great Pittsburgh is. It was also a little bit too casual almost bordering on unprofessional. Unlike the first round where they prepared us well for what to expect, the final round seemed like more a gotcha game with surprise challenges. It felt like America's Next Top Model and not in a good way. It seemed like the chosen few were already hired and pretty much just had to show up. Everyone else was basically a seat filler. Overall, I feel like they hired people who are a lot like the people who already work there.

Interviewed Nov 2009 (took 3 days)
Phone interview was basic from a HR standpoint and then the interview process included multiple 1 on 1 interviews. If passed, a super day was scheduled with all canddiates at their headquarters in Pittsburgh, PA. The 3 day process included presentations, challenges, and group interviews.
